Program: |
Medical Office Assistant |
|
School: |
Everest College |
|
Location: |
Springfield, Missouri MO |
|
Description: |
The purpose of this program is to develop skills in four key areas: medical terminology, medical office administrative skills, medical transcription, and word processing. In addition, the program fosters the development of interpersonal skills, organizational effectiveness, and communication skills necessary to function in a medical environment.
